Team Support
Team Support is the group of people committed to supporting Interserve Long Term and Short Term Partners through prayer, relationship and financial support. This commitment means that Partners, Supporters and Interserve are linked together — in faith and dependence on God’s provision.
One of our principles is that Team Support is fully pledged before an Interserve Partner is sent overseas. This means that each and every Partner has the financial support required for their first term overseas and they don't need to worry about raising more finances while they are away.
For our Partners who work primarily in community development, support is tax deductible for the Australian donor. Support for Partners who are primarily involved in church work is not tax deductible.

Emergency Medical, Compassionate Support
It’s important to us
that you are provided for in the case of medical emergency. Interserve
Australia provides Emergency Medical Evacuation Insurance for all
Partners in each of our regions. Emergency compassionate leave
insurance is also available to Partners at their own expense. While
serving overseas with Interserve, Partners and their children are
covered by Interserve’s International Medical Fund.
